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Robroyston to Winchmore Hill start from £127.90 one way, or £182.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Robroyston to Winchmore Hill are available for £196.50 one way, or £393.00 return

Facilities and Amenities at Robroyston

Robroyston station is well-equipped to support both frequent travelers and those new to the rail system. Although it does not have a staffed ticket office, it provides modern ticket machines for purchasing and collecting tickets, including those bought online. It supports the use of smartcards, with validators available, though it should be noted that no smartcards are issued directly at this station.

Designed with accessibility in mind, Robroyston offers step-free access throughout, ensuring ease of movement for all passengers. There are also customer help points for quick assistance, although there is no direct staff help available on-site. Although waiting shelters are provided, travelers will not find extensive seating, refreshment facilities, or toilets within the station.

For those commuting by bike, the station offers 32 bicycle storage spaces, ensuring a secure option for eco-friendly travel. Should you be arriving by car, you'll appreciate that the parking, with 231 spaces including 20 accessible spots, is free, adding convenience to your journey.

Facilities and Amenities at Winchmore Hill

Winchmore Hill station is well-equipped for ticket purchasing and collection, boasting a ticket office and machines. The ticket office operates Monday to Friday from 06:50 to 13:15, and Saturday from 08:30 to 14:00. For those planning digitally, online tickets can be collected directly from the ticket machines.

Accessibility features are present, although the station does not offer step-free access. However, there are accessible ticket machines available, compatible with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. For those requiring additional assistance, staff are on hand and can be booked in advance for a smoother travel experience. Note that waiting room facilities and accessible toilets are not available, although seating areas are provided.
